Exodus 28:15-31 The Breastpiece

 Exodus 28:15-31 The Breastpiece








Like many of the items the Breastpiece should be made for the same items


Exodus 28:15

“Fashion a breastpiece for making decisions–the work of a skilled craftsman. Make it like the ephod: of gold, and of blue, purple and scarlet yarn, and of finely twisted linen.


It is a square, a span by a span, and folded double. There was to be four rows of precious stones.


1st row: ruby, topaz, beryl

2nd row: turquoise, sapphire, emerald

3rd row: jacinth, agate, amethyst 

4th row: chrysolite, onyx, jasper


The setting for the stones are to be gold.  Each of the stone represents each of the twelve tribes of Israel.  They were to make braided chains of pure gold that would be put through gold rings that are fastened on two corners of the breastpiece.  The breastpiece is to be attached to the Ephod by gold rings.  


Exodus 28:29-30

“Whenever Aaron enters the Holy Place, he will bear the names of the sons of Israel over his heart on the breastpiece of decision as a continuing memorial before the LORD. Also put the Urim and the Thummim in the breastpiece, so they may be over Aaron’s heart whenever he enters the presence of the LORD. Thus Aaron will always bear the means of making decisions for the Israelites over his heart before the LORD.
